Post by clifford on Jun 13, 2023 10:42:14 GMT -5
I have way more interest in the Gunns than boring-ass Bullet Club. Couldn't agree more, people said the nWo outstayed their welcome and they were around for four years, Bullet Club has been around for a decade now. What's funny is that Bullet Club in Japan is arguably the most interesting its been since the Elite left in early 2019. David Finlay, with a major character and in ring overhaul, is now leading the group and stocking it with viscous, young, incredibly talented wrestlers, most of them out of Shibata's LA Dojo. It's harkening back to the original formation of the Bullet Club- a group of pissed off foreign wrestlers intent on laying waste to NJPW's old guard. Bullet Club Gold in comparison is just...lame, sorry, no two ways about it. I love Jay, I love Juice, I like the Gunns, but this is dookie. They should all be doing something away from BC.

Bullet Club at its best is why I wish BCG was named literally anything else. It loses just about everything about it that's interesting when it goes stateside. It brought ROH a lot of money and attention, but a lot of that hype wave was because it had guys in it who were too good to ignore. Taguchi Japan would've been the ROH megadraw if it had Styles, the Bucks, and Omega it. But Bullet Club as a name is too profitable to resist and they probably have eyes on an Eltie vs. BCG feud so the whole concept is gonna have to get weighed down by the baggage of being a franchise of a group whose proper hook is in stuff that literally does not map to an American promotion.
